| 5 // Dart test for linked hash-maps. | |
| 6 | |
| 7 class LinkedHashMapTest { | |
| 8 static void testMain() { | |
| 9 Map map = new LinkedHashMap(); | |
| 10 map["a"] = 1; | |
| 11 map["b"] = 2; | |
| 12 map["c"] = 3; | |
| 13 map["d"] = 4; | |
| 14 map["e"] = 5; | |
| 15 | |
| 16 List<String> keys = new List<String>(5); | |
| 17 List<int> values = new List<int>(5); | |
| 18 | |
| 19 int index; | |
| 20 | |
| 21 clear() { | |
| 22 index = 0; | |
| 23 for (int i = 0; i < keys.length; i++) { | |
| 24 keys[i] = null; | |
| 25 values[i] = null; | |
| 26 } | |
| 27 } | |
| 28 | |
| 29 verifyKeys(List<String> correctKeys) { | |
| 30 for (int i = 0; i < correctKeys.length; i++) { | |
| 31 Expect.equals(correctKeys[i], keys[i]); | |
| 32 } | |
| 33 } | |
| 34 | |
| 35 verifyValues(List<int> correctValues) { | |
| 36 for (int i = 0; i < correctValues.length; i++) { | |
| 37 Expect.equals(correctValues[i], values[i]); | |
| 38 } | |
| 39 } | |
| 40 | |
| 41 testForEachMap(Object key, Object value) { | |
| 42 Expect.equals(map[key], value); | |
| 43 keys[index] = key; | |
| 44 values[index] = value; | |
| 45 index++; | |
| 46 } | |
| 47 | |
| 48 testForEachValue(Object v) { | |
| 49 values[index++] = v; | |
| 50 } | |
| 51 | |
| 52 testForEachKey(Object v) { | |
| 53 keys[index++] = v; | |
| 54 } | |
| 55 | |
| 56 final keysInOrder = const ["a", "b", "c", "d", "e"]; | |
| 57 final valuesInOrder = const [1, 2, 3, 4, 5]; | |
| 58 | |
| 59 clear(); | |
| 60 map.forEach(testForEachMap); | |
| 61 verifyKeys(keysInOrder); | |
| 62 verifyValues(valuesInOrder); | |
| 63 | |
| 64 clear(); | |
| 65 map.getKeys().forEach(testForEachKey); | |
| 66 verifyKeys(keysInOrder); | |
| 67 | |
| 68 clear(); | |
| 69 map.getValues().forEach(testForEachValue); | |
| 70 verifyValues(valuesInOrder); | |
| 71 | |
| 72 // Remove and then insert. | |
| 73 map.remove("b"); | |
| 74 map["b"] = 6; | |
| 75 final keysAfterBMove = const ["a", "c", "d", "e", "b"]; | |
| 76 final valuesAfterBMove = const [1, 3, 4, 5, 6]; | |
| 77 | |
| 78 | |
| 79 clear(); | |
| 80 map.forEach(testForEachMap); | |
| 81 verifyKeys(keysAfterBMove); | |
| 82 verifyValues(valuesAfterBMove); | |
| 83 | |
| 84 clear(); | |
| 85 map.getKeys().forEach(testForEachKey); | |
| 86 verifyKeys(keysAfterBMove); | |
| 87 | |
| 88 clear(); | |
| 89 map.getValues().forEach(testForEachValue); | |
| 90 verifyValues(valuesAfterBMove); | |
| 91 | |
| 92 // Update. | |
| 93 map["a"] = 0; | |
| 94 final valuesAfterAUpdate = const [0, 3, 4, 5, 6]; | |
| 95 | |
| 96 clear(); | |
| 97 map.forEach(testForEachMap); | |
| 98 verifyKeys(keysAfterBMove); | |
| 99 verifyValues(valuesAfterAUpdate); | |
| 100 | |
| 101 clear(); | |
| 102 map.getKeys().forEach(testForEachKey); | |
| 103 verifyKeys(keysAfterBMove); | |
| 104 | |
| 105 clear(); | |
| 106 map.getValues().forEach(testForEachValue); | |
| 107 verifyValues(valuesAfterAUpdate); | |
| 108 } | |
| 109 } | |
| 110 | |
| 111 main() { | |
| 112 LinkedHashMapTest.testMain(); | |
| 113 } | |
